当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储技术架构包括哪些内容,深入解析对象存储技术架构,核心组成部分与关键技术

对象存储技术架构包括哪些内容,深入解析对象存储技术架构,核心组成部分与关键技术

对象存储技术架构涵盖存储节点、元数据管理、数据冗余、数据安全、访问控制等关键内容。核心组成部分包括存储节点、元数据服务器和对象存储服务。关键技术包括数据分片、数据复制、...

对象存储技术架构涵盖存储节点、元数据管理、数据冗余、数据安全、访问控制等关键内容。核心组成部分包括存储节点、元数据服务器和对象存储服务。关键技术包括数据分片、数据复制、数据校验和负载均衡。深入解析有助于理解其高效、可靠和可扩展的特点。

随着互联网、大数据、云计算等技术的快速发展,数据存储需求呈现出爆发式增长,对象存储作为一种新型的数据存储技术,因其独特的优势,逐渐成为企业存储解决方案的首选,本文将从对象存储技术架构的角度,详细解析其核心组成部分与关键技术,以期为相关领域的研究和开发提供参考。

对象存储技术架构概述

对象存储技术架构主要包括以下五个部分:

对象存储技术架构包括哪些内容,深入解析对象存储技术架构,核心组成部分与关键技术

1、存储节点(Storage Node)

存储节点是对象存储系统中的基本单元,负责存储和管理数据,每个存储节点通常由硬件设备和软件系统组成,硬件设备包括磁盘、网络设备等,软件系统则负责数据的读写、存储、备份、恢复等操作。

2、网络架构

网络架构是对象存储系统的通信基础,主要包括以下几种:

(1)数据中心内部网络:连接存储节点和数据中心内部的其他设备,如服务器、交换机等。

(2)数据中心之间网络:连接不同数据中心,实现数据迁移和备份。

(3)客户端网络:连接客户端和对象存储系统,实现数据的上传、下载等操作。

3、元数据管理

元数据管理是对象存储系统的重要组成部分,负责存储和管理对象的元数据信息,元数据主要包括以下内容:

(1)对象信息:如对象名称、类型、大小、创建时间、修改时间等。

(2)存储信息:如存储节点、存储路径、存储容量等。

(3)访问控制信息:如权限、访问策略等。

4、存储策略

存储策略是指对象存储系统在存储过程中所遵循的一系列规则,主要包括以下几种:

对象存储技术架构包括哪些内容,深入解析对象存储技术架构,核心组成部分与关键技术

(1)数据分布策略:如数据副本、数据冗余等。

(2)数据备份策略:如全备份、增量备份等。

(3)数据恢复策略:如数据恢复、故障转移等。

5、安全性

安全性是对象存储系统的重要保障,主要包括以下方面:

(1)数据加密:对存储数据进行加密,确保数据安全。

(2)访问控制:对用户权限进行控制,防止未授权访问。

(3)审计日志:记录用户操作日志,便于追踪和审计。

对象存储技术架构的关键技术

1、数据分片(Sharding)

数据分片是将大量数据分散存储到多个存储节点上的技术,通过数据分片,可以提高数据读写效率,降低单点故障风险。

2、数据复制(Replication)

数据复制是指将数据同步或异步复制到多个存储节点上的技术,数据复制可以提高数据可用性和可靠性。

3、数据去重(De-duplication)

数据去重是指识别并删除重复数据的技术,数据去重可以减少存储空间占用,提高存储效率。

对象存储技术架构包括哪些内容,深入解析对象存储技术架构,核心组成部分与关键技术

4、数据压缩(Compression)

数据压缩是指将数据以更小的体积存储的技术,数据压缩可以提高存储空间利用率,降低存储成本。

5、数据快照(Snapshot)

数据快照是指创建数据某一时刻的副本,以便在需要时恢复数据,数据快照可以提高数据恢复速度,降低数据丢失风险。

6、数据迁移(Migration)

数据迁移是指将数据从一个存储系统迁移到另一个存储系统的技术,数据迁移可以方便地扩展存储系统,提高系统性能。

7、高可用性(High Availability)

高可用性是指系统在故障情况下仍能正常运行的能力,高可用性可以通过数据复制、故障转移等技术实现。

8、安全性(Security)

安全性是指系统抵御外部攻击、保护数据不被非法访问的能力,安全性可以通过数据加密、访问控制等技术实现。

对象存储技术架构作为新型数据存储技术,具有广泛的应用前景,本文从对象存储技术架构的角度,详细解析了其核心组成部分与关键技术,了解和掌握对象存储技术架构,有助于企业更好地应对数据存储需求,提高数据存储效率,降低存储成本。

黑狐家游戏

发表评论

最新文章